Background
Roscommon based System Label is a specialist printer of industrial labels for multinational manufacturers in the electronics, automotive and medical sectors. A wholly owned subsidiary of German company System Label GmbH, System Label has been in Ireland since 1992 and has grown to a staff of 45.
Business Requirement
The business for System Label in Ireland was generated from two sources. 50-70% of business was related to clients of the parent company in Germany - Daimler Chrysler, Siemens, and Bosch to name a few. These orders were processed through the German plant but production happened in Roscommon.
A system was required which would allow both plants to share data relating to:
- Orders.
- Basic stock control of raw materials (in each plant).
- Delivery notes.
- Invoicing.
- Stock control of finished goods.
- Quotations.
Solution
Genbase Solutions worked in partnership with System Label over a period of a year to deliver a solution capable of supporting the business requirement. This solution was based on based on automatic transfer of data via a secure VPN.
Initially both plants had implemented
standard systems (based on bespoke modules developed in house and by
Genbase), then a data transfer module was developed and implemented.
This module controlled the flow of information between the two
plants, it managed the schedule of updates and dealt with update
conflicts between the two data sources.

System
Architecture
- MS Access 2000
- Data transfer application developed using VBA and Win FTP.
